@Motofool has pretty much answered the question. Let me rephrase: 1.) Increased lean does NOT necessarily mean speed. 2.) The 250 doesn't need that much lean to go through a corner at an equivalent or greater speed than a bigger/heavier bike. 3.) The frame and suspension of the 250 is not built for such extreme angles and gets quite dangerous. The bike construction doesn't lend to Moto-GP lean angles - the footpegs and frame are too wide, the controls are too wide, the exhaust is too wide and the tires are not wide enough. There is another issue here which has not been mentioned, and that is tire profile. A race and road ride of an equivalent width would look completely different. A road tire is almost an exact semi circle on it's profile. A race tire looks more like the "sharp" side of an egg. The reason for this is so that when you are riding on the side of the tire it has a greater profile providing grip, and when up and down it has less rolling resistance. So, considering just the tire profile and Motofool's equation, the 250 doesn't have the power, for the speed to be able to provide enough centripetal force to be able to get that low, nor does it support tire sizes (except for the 120/150 mods) to accommodate race tires with the appropriate profiles. To make a 250 lean like a MotoGP bike: 1.) Get a moto gp racer. 2.) redesign the entire bike with a box frame optimized for side-flex since the forks effectively stop working at extreme lean angles and a narrow frame width for foot positions which will clear extreme lean angles and an underslung or tail exhaust 3.) add 20hp 4.) run at least 120/150 race profile tires Now, back to your regular scheduled circle jerk. Pictures are good!
I run diablo rosso corsas on my track wheels, 120 and 150 on a regular rim. With the regular rim it pinches the tire in, and although not a wonderful solution, the edge of the tire ends up being completely vertical, which means when I scrape hard parts the tire still has 0.75" of chicken strip. I'm no good on the track, and usually the slowest, and the only way to use more of that tire is to narrow the bottom middle of the frame, where the rearsets bolts on to provide more clearance. Are there any other factors? Also, definitely agreed on more pics!
